ZIP code 37362 in Old Fort, Tennessee has a population of 3,395. The median household income is $52,019, which is 32% below the national average. Median home value is $122,700, 56% below the US average. 13.4%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

ZIP code 37362 is classified by USPS as a standard delivery area and covers roughly 196.2 square miles in Old Fort, Polk County, Tennessee. The area is home to 3,395 residents, producing a population density of 17 people per square mile, and falls within the New York time zone. These USPS and Census boundary values drive every downstream statistic on this page, including the benchmarks that compare 37362 against Tennessee and the nation.

On the economic side, the median household income for ZIP 37362 sits at $52,019 (22% below the Tennessee average), while per-capita income is $24,445. The poverty rate stands at 16.5% and the unemployment rate at 14.6%. On housing, the median home value is $122,700 (50% below the state average) with median rent at $1,023 per month, and 91.0% of occupied units are owner-occupied, a direct signal of whether 37362 behaves more like a homeowner neighborhood or a renter-heavy ZIP.

Education and household profile round out the picture: 13.4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 43.1, and the average commute is 33 minutes. Census Bureau data shows 21 business establishments in ZIP 37362, employing approximately 89 people with a combined annual payroll of $3,239,000.
